Kathleen S. Schmitt is an ordained Anglican priest with an interest in feminism and feminine representations of the Divine. Having spent time working in post-war El Salvador and travelling through Mexico and Central America, she has seen the suffering and poverty in those locations firsthand, and she’s committed to supporting movements for justice in a variety of settings.

In El Salvador, Kathleen worked directly with people of all ages who were members of the parish of Santísima Trinidad, the Episcopal Church of El Salvador, in San Martín, not far from San Salvador. Most parishioners were market women and their children.

She’s a member of Cristosal, which is a human rights organization in Central America, the Writers Union of Canada, the Canadian Authors Association, and the BC Federation of Writers.
 
Ms. Schmitt has authored three other books: Seasons of the Feminine Divine: Christian Feminist Prayers for the Liturgical Cycle in three volumes (1993, 1994, 1995), and two online young adult novels titled Soaring with Amelia and Getting a Life. In her spare time, she enjoys reading and walking.
 
Ms. Schmitt and her husband, Ed, live in North Vancouver, British Columbia.
